    Unique Features

    * Long term staff
    * Each room has kitchenette and private patio or balcony
    * Spacious rooms
    * Chapel on site with Catholic and Protestant services Tues, Thurs, and Sunday. Catholic church picks up residents for Sunday service
    * Nice grounds on 4.5 acres.
    * Special events, acitivities and clubs w/ ongoing cultural enrichment programs. Quiet neighborhood but very close to Valley Parkway shopping.
    * Relatively evenly balanced between men and women residents

    Additional Services

    Diabetic Care
    Diabetic residents must be able to manage their own care, including blood sugar tests and insulin injections.

    Memory Care Offered
    This community employs technology to prevent residents from wandering and becoming lost, for example bracelets that will ring an alarm if the resident leaves the community.

    Incontinence Care
    Incontinent residents must be able to manage incontinence themselves. This staff at this community can remind incontinent residents to use the restroom. This community can care for residents with bowel incontinence. This community can care for residents with bladder incontinence.

    Non Ambulatory Care
    This community can provide a 2 person assisted transfer for residents who need help transferring, for example, from a bed into a wheelchair.

    Other Care
    This community provides multiple levels of care allowing residents to remain at the community while receiving increasing care.

This is the best home away from home for our mother!

reviewed on: 10/07/2020 by Dora W.

My 72-year-old mother has resided at Pacifica Senior Living in Escondido for more than five years and I must say that choosing this facility was the best & hardest decision my sister and I have ever made. At first, mom was reluctant to give up her apartment and live among strangers. She thought she was letting go of her freedom but this was far from the truth. We simply needed for someone to monitor her daily medications, prepare healthy meals and do light housecleaning. Mom could no longer do these simple tasks on her own and we were not able to provide the proper supervision. Walking into Pacifica is like walking into a warm-home like environment with many common areas that foster friendship and socialization. There are big comfy chairs, large TVs, a popcorn machine, a hair salon, a chapel, a lil store for necessities, a game room, planting boxes, and lots of outdoor seating with views of the manicured roses. The roses are my favorite. The front desk manager has answered the phone for years and seems to know the coming and going of every resident. No matter when I call, she tells me immediately how my mom is doing and where she is whether it is the dining room, vising with friends or taking a nap. When walking the hallway with my mom, the residents all seem to know her name. My mom feels popular. Residents share tips on the newest walkers & wheelchairs, who the new guy is, and pet the heads of the little dogs following behind. The cleaning staff is wonderful. They seem to have built a special bond with my mom and know exactly how she likes to keep her things. They close the door quickly so my mom's cat doesn't get out. On occasion, mom has asked to call me back because she has a friend over (the cleaning staff). The same is said for the nurses at Pacifica. Medications are provided several times per day by medical professionals. When we take mom away for the weekend, the nurse will pack a bag of her daily pills and instructions on time to take and if food is required. Speaking of food, the meals at Pacifica are terrific, nutritious and plentiful. When grandkids are visiting, the kitchen has made quesadillas, peanut butter & jelly sandwiches, chicken noodle soup, or a second helping of dessert on request. We all leave the table full, including those picky teenagers. Guests are always welcome and the grandkids love to visit. They say the place smells normal, not like old people, and there's always lots of food and lots of stuff to do. The calendar is posted with the daily activities including field trips, bingo, movie night, etc. The kids like the WII bowling. Due to the great leadership of Pacifica management, my mom has felt safe and independent. With the managers focus on love and hospitality, my sister and I feel a big sense of relief knowing mom is happy. We recently asked mom if she would like to come live with us and she said, “No thanks honey, I would miss my friends too much.” Thank you, Jackie and staff, for creating a home environment and loving the residents like family!
